-2
私は、上で動作するプロジェクトを持っている一つのソースコードを持っており、彼らは複数のバージョンつscourceコード複数のWebアプリケーション
すなわちを必要としますこれの背後にある技術は何ですか?
私は、上で動作するプロジェクトを持っている一つのソースコードを持っており、彼らは複数のバージョンつscourceコード複数のWebアプリケーション
すなわちを必要としますこれの背後にある技術は何ですか?
ドメインがすべて同じコードベースを指しているようにするには、すべてのドメインが同じディレクトリを指すようにサーバーを設定するだけです。ホスティングのセットアップに関する詳細情報がないと、一般性しか与えられません。
コントロールパネルで何らかの共有ホスティングを使用している場合は、「パークドドメイン」機能が利用可能な可能性があります。独自の環境を管理する場合、各ドメインはおそらく/var/www/
に独自のフォルダを持っています。余分なフォルダを削除し、名前をコードベースの正規のコピーにシンボリックリンクするだけです。
あなたは正しいです。しかし、ここに私は内容が動的に関連しているドメインに要求が来る。私はこのCMS上でフレームワークを使用しないので、n個のドメインに対してn個の異なるサイトフォルダを使用する必要があります。または、それらをすべて動的にロードする方がよいでしょう。 – TED
PHPで '$ _SERVER ['SERVER_NAME']'をチェックしてください。ユーザーがサイトにアクセスするために使用したドメイン名が含まれます。その後、ドメイン名に応じてユーザーを別々に扱うことができます。 – Interrobang